LVT for the Kitchen

LVT (Luxury Vinyl Tile) is a highly practical and design-led choice for kitchen flooring, offering a balance of durability, comfort and water resistance. Kitchens require a floor that can handle daily use, moisture and regular cleaning while maintaining a clean and considered appearance. LVT provides this by replicating the look of natural wood and stone in a more reliable and low-maintenance format.

Across our LVT collection, including leading brands such as Amtico, Karndean, Invictus and Project Floors, you can explore a wide range of styles suited to both contemporary and traditional kitchens. Whether you are creating an open-plan layout or a more defined kitchen space, LVT offers a consistent and hard-wearing foundation.

The kitchen places more demands on flooring than almost any other room. From spills and splashes to constant foot traffic, the surface needs to perform consistently. LVT offers a durable and stable surface that resists scratches, stains and everyday impact.

Its waterproof construction makes it particularly suitable for kitchens, where exposure to moisture is unavoidable. Liquids can be easily wiped away without affecting the floor.

LVT offers a wide range of design options, from wood-effect planks that introduce warmth to stone and concrete finishes that create a more contemporary look. Patterned layouts can also be used to define areas within open-plan spaces.

Compared to harder materials, LVT provides a softer and more comfortable surface underfoot. It also helps reduce noise and works effectively with underfloor heating.

With its ease of maintenance and reliable performance, LVT is a practical and long-lasting flooring solution for kitchens.

Buying Guide

Choosing the right LVT for your kitchen requires careful thought. Here’s a detailed guide to help you select the perfect product.

Room Usage / Location: The kitchen is a high-traffic, high-moisture area. You should choose an LVT with a wear layer of at least 0.3mm to ensure long-term durability and resistance to scratches and scuffs.
Lifestyle: LVT is an ideal choice for active family homes with children and pets. Its resilience to spills and stains makes it a practical and worry-free option for the inevitable accidents that happen in a kitchen.
Budget: LVT provides the luxurious look of natural materials at a more accessible price point. The cost will depend on the wear layer thickness, brand, and design, but it offers excellent long-term value due to its longevity and low maintenance.
Durability & Maintenance: Look for a product with a robust wear layer (0.3mm or higher) and a good residential warranty. Maintenance is simple: regular sweeping or vacuuming and occasional damp mopping with a pH-neutral cleaner are all that’s needed to keep it clean and hygienic.
Material Type Pros & Cons: Pros include superior water resistance, durability, easy maintenance, and warmth underfoot. The main con is its synthetic nature, which some people may not prefer to a natural material.
Aesthetics & Style: With a huge variety of wood and stone effects, you can find an LVT design that complements any kitchen style, from modern and minimalist to rustic and traditional. The realistic textures add an authentic feel.
Comfort & Sound: For a kitchen, comfort underfoot is a significant benefit. LVT is softer and warmer than ceramic or stone tiles and also helps to absorb sound, making for a quieter and more pleasant kitchen environment.
Underfloor Heating: LVT is fully compatible with underfloor heating systems. This is a great feature for kitchens, as it can make the floor a comfortable temperature on cold mornings.
Installation: For a kitchen, both Click LVT and Glue Down LVT are excellent options. Click LVT is faster and easier for a DIY project, while Glue Down offers maximum stability and a more permanent bond.
Sustainability: Many reputable manufacturers are committed to producing LVT responsibly, with products that are phthalate-free and have low VOC emissions. Look for products with recognised environmental certifications.

Frequently asked questions

Is LVT waterproof for a kitchen?
Yes, LVT is inherently waterproof, which makes it a perfect choice for kitchens. The surface of the tiles will not be damaged by water. When installed correctly, the planks and tiles create a tight, seamless barrier that prevents spills from reaching the subfloor, protecting your home from water damage.

How does LVT compare to real wood in a kitchen?
LVT is a far more practical choice for a kitchen. It is waterproof and highly resistant to scratches and stains, whereas real wood is vulnerable to water damage, warping, and requires careful maintenance. LVT offers the beautiful look of wood without any of the associated drawbacks.

Will dropping heavy items damage my kitchen LVT?
High-quality LVT with a thick wear layer is highly durable and resistant to impact. While a very heavy or sharp object could cause damage, LVT is generally much more forgiving than ceramic or stone tiles, which can chip or crack. In the event of damage, individual LVT planks or tiles can often be replaced, making repairs straightforward.
